In today’s fast-paced world, technology has revolutionized the way we consume entertainment and content. One such innovation that has become increasingly popular is simulcast. This term refers to the broadcast of a program across multiple platforms or channels simultaneously. Whether it’s a live sports event, a concert, or a special event, simulcast allows content to reach a wider audience in real-time.

The concept of simulcast has been around for decades, but with the rise of streaming services and social media platforms, it has become more prevalent than ever before. The ability to watch or listen to an event as it happens, regardless of your location, has transformed the way we interact with media.

One of the key benefits of simulcast is its ability to reach a larger audience. In the past, if you wanted to watch a live event, you had to be in a specific location or have access to a particular channel. With simulcast, anyone with an internet connection can tune in and experience the event in real-time. This has opened up new opportunities for content creators to connect with a global audience.
